'A problem waiting to happen': Headstrong elk euthanized after confrontation video goes viral

A young elk was put down late Friday after being put in the spotlight by an amateur video that caught the animal headbutting a nature photographer, officials said.

The footage, which went viral last week, showed lensman James York sitting beside a road in the Great Smoky Mountain National Park in Asheville, North Carolina, as the one-and-a-half-year-old elk continues to headbutt him and periodically jab its antlers.

The YouTubed incident was the tipping point for park officials since the elk had a history of unmanageable behavior, Dana Soehn, a spokeswoman at the Great Smoky Mountains National Park, told NBC News.

Soehn said that since September the elk had been "hazed" an estimated 28 times. Hazing includes shooting the animal with bean bags and paint balls, running after the elk as well as lighting firecrackers to scare it off, Soehn explained.
